  • Coach Gladys M. Lee, LPGA Professional Teacher and Coach, is the Founder and Executive Director of Roaring Lambs International Junior Golf Academy. With a long and respected career in golf since entering the industry in 1986, she has developed curricula that combine golf training and life skills for multi-ethnic children, while contributing her talents, abilities, and service to organizations, corporations, and non-profits for decades. Tiger Woods recognized Lee’s Roaring Lambs organization as one of the top junior golf programs in the United States, which led to its feature on the NBC Tom Brokaw segment “Making a Difference.” Lee, a Class A member of the LPGA, resides in Dallas, Texas. She also serves as a high school, college, and professional golf scout, a Hurricane Junior Golf Tour recruiter, and the Founder and CEO of Roaring Lambs International Junior Golf. In addition, she is the Site Director for LPGA-USGA Girls Golf in Fort Worth and Dallas West, a U.S. Kids Certified Golf Coach, and a Double Goal Positive Coaching Alliance (PCA) coach.
